2026-07-072026-07-07http://salesiana.dossiersoluciones.com/handle/123456789/47531The backgrounds due to the direct diffractive dissociation of the photon into the $π^+π^-$ as well as $K^+K^-$ pairs to the "elastic" diffractive $ρ'$ and $ϕ$ mesons production in electron-proton collisions are calculated. It is shown that the role of background and background-resonant interference contributions is very important in experimental distribution of $M_{π^+ π^-}$ in the $ρ'$ mass region. The amplitude for the background process is proportional to the $π$-meson - proton or K-meson - proton cross sections. Therefore, describing the HERA data, one can estimate $σ(πp)$ and $σ(Kp)$ at energies higher than the region of direct measurements.11 pages, LaTeX, 5 figures in 9 additional eps filesHigh Energy Physics - PhenomenologyElastic ρ' and ϕMeson Photo- and Electroproduction with Non-Resonant Backgroundtext
